On January 3rd, 1931, Dr. Jekyll and Mr. Hyde (1931) was released nationwide in the US.
Released 11 years after a silent film version starring John Barrymore and 10 years before a 1941 remake starring Spencer Tracy, Ingrid Bergman and Lana Turner.
This Reuben Mamoulian directed version is the most critically and commercially successful adaptation of the Robert Louis Stevenson novel.

On December 29th, 1939, The Hunchback of Notre Dame was released in US theaters.
| The Hunchback of Notre Dame |
This is one of many film adaptations of Victor Hugo’s 1831 novel but likely one of the most definitive.
| Victor Hugo’s 1831 novel |
Starring Charles Laughton, Maureen O’Hara, Sir Cedric Hardwicke and Thomas Mitchell. Directed by William Dieterle and adapted by Sonya Levien and Bruno Frank.

Nichelle Nichols was born on December 28th, 1932 in Robbins, Illinois, a suburb of Chicago.
| Nichelle Nichols |
Best known for her role as Nyota Uhura in Gene Roddenberry’s Star Trek.
| Nyota Uhura |
She is one of four surviving members of the original series including William Shatner, George Takei and Walter Koenig.
